The Influence of Geometry and Pattern in Design

Geometry serves as a foundational element in both architecture and visual arts, including those forms akin to spinogambino. From the precise angles of a Gothic cathedral to the complex arrangements within intricate designs, geometric principles define structure and influence aesthetic perception. The use of repeating patterns, for instance, can create a sense of harmony and order, while asymmetrical compositions can evoke dynamism and contrast. In architecture, these principles dictate stability and functionality, while in art, they contribute to visual interest and conceptual depth. The manipulation of shapes and forms allows designers and artists to guide the viewer's eye and control the emotional impact of their work. Consider the prevalence of the golden ratio in classical architecture – a testament to the enduring appeal of mathematically harmonious proportions.

The Role of Fractals and Natural Forms

Beyond basic geometric shapes, the incorporation of fractals and natural forms adds another layer of complexity to design. Fractals, characterized by self-similarity at different scales, are found abundantly in nature and can be used to create visually captivating and organic-looking structures. Architects and artists alike draw inspiration from nature’s inherent patterns, mimicking the branching of trees, the swirling of shells, and the intricate arrangements of leaves. This biomimicry not only enhances aesthetic appeal but also often results in designs that are more efficient, sustainable, and resilient. The use of natural materials and forms can also foster a stronger connection between the built environment and the natural world, promoting a sense of well-being and harmony.

The Significance of Color and Texture

Color and texture are potent tools in the designer’s arsenal, capable of evoking a wide range of emotions and influencing perceptions. In architecture, the choice of materials and color palettes can dramatically alter the mood and atmosphere of a space. Warm colors, such as reds and oranges, tend to create a sense of intimacy and energy, while cool colors, like blues and greens, can promote calmness and serenity. The texture of surfaces – whether smooth, rough, or patterned – further contributes to the tactile and visual experience. Similarly, in artistic expressions, color and texture play a crucial role in conveying meaning and evoking emotional responses. Consider the use of vibrant colors in a painting to express joy or the use of rough textures to convey a sense of hardship or decay. The skillful manipulation of these elements can create works that are both visually stunning and emotionally resonant.

The Psychology of Color in Design

The psychological impact of color is well-documented, and designers often leverage this knowledge to create specific effects. For example, blue is often associated with trust and stability, making it a popular choice for corporate branding. Yellow is perceived as cheerful and optimistic, but can also be overwhelming if used excessively. Red is associated with passion and energy, but can also evoke feelings of anger or danger. Understanding these associations allows designers to strategically use color to influence consumer behavior, create desired moods, and reinforce brand identities. The careful consideration of color palettes is essential for creating designs that are not only aesthetically pleasing but also psychologically effective. The Role of Light and Shadow

Light and shadow are fundamental elements of design, shaping our perception of form, space, and texture. In architecture, the manipulation of natural and artificial light can dramatically alter the atmosphere of a building, creating a sense of drama, intimacy, or spaciousness. The play of light and shadow reveals the contours of surfaces, accentuates architectural details, and creates a dynamic visual experience. Similarly, in artistic endeavors, light and shadow are used to create depth, dimension, and contrast, guiding the viewer’s eye and emphasizing key elements. The use of chiaroscuro, a technique that employs strong contrasts between light and dark, is a classic example of how light and shadow can be used to create a dramatic and emotionally powerful effect. Techniques for Manipulating Light and Shadow

Several techniques can be used to manipulate light and shadow in design. Architects and designers employ strategies such as strategically placed windows, skylights, and artificial lighting fixtures to control the distribution of light within a space. The use of shading devices, such as overhangs and louvers, can filter sunlight and reduce glare. Artists utilize techniques such as layering, scumbling, and glazing to create subtle gradations of light and shadow. The careful consideration of light sources, angles, and intensities is crucial for achieving the desired effect. Furthermore, the interplay between light and material properties—such as reflectivity and transparency—can significantly impact the visual outcome. Sustainable Design and Environmental Consciousness

Contemporary design increasingly embraces principles of sustainability and environmental consciousness. Architects and artists are exploring innovative ways to minimize their environmental impact, conserve resources, and create designs that are harmonious with the natural world. This includes the use of sustainable materials, energy-efficient technologies, and passive design strategies. For example, architects might incorporate green roofs, rainwater harvesting systems, and solar panels into their designs to reduce a building’s carbon footprint. Artists are utilizing recycled materials, eco-friendly paints, and sustainable production methods to create environmentally responsible artworks. Exploring Emerging Technologies in Creative Fields

The rapid advancement of technology is profoundly impacting the creative fields. Digital design tools, such as Building Information Modeling (BIM) software and computer-aided design (CAD) programs, are revolutionizing the way architects and designers visualize, create, and collaborate on projects. 3D printing allows for the creation of complex and customized forms that were previously impossible to achieve. Virtual and augmented reality technologies are enabling immersive design experiences, allowing clients and stakeholders to explore designs in a realistic and interactive way. These advancements are opening up new possibilities for creative expression and pushing the boundaries of what is possible in both architecture and the arts. The integration of artificial intelligence (AI) into design processes also presents exciting opportunities. AI algorithms can be used to generate design options, optimize building performance, and personalize user experiences. While AI is unlikely to replace human designers entirely, it can serve as a powerful tool to augment their creativity and enhance their problem-solving abilities. The future of design will undoubtedly be shaped by the continued evolution of these technologies and the innovative ways in which they are applied to address the challenges and opportunities of the 21st century.
